A van has been recovered after coming off a slipway at St Ouen’s Bay and landing on its roof on rocks below.

The handbrake on the silver Volkswagen failed, causing it to go over the edge of the slip near Sands. It is understood that no one was injured in the incident.

A recovery team from No 1 Recovery worked to lift the silver Volkswagen from the rocks ahead of the incoming tide, with the Coastguard also on site to assist.

The van was hoisted from the shoreline just in time as water began to pool around the rocks.
